Properties of 2 ‘notorious’ drug paddlers attached
Srinagar: Police in Pulwama today attached several properties of two “notorious” drug peddlers under section 8/21-29 NDPS Act 1985, a police spokesman informed.
The properties attached included a double-storied residential house valuing approximately Rs 20,97,291 belonging to a drug peddler Fayaz Ahmad Rather, son of Ghulam Mohammad Rather, resident of Karimabad; and two shops with 2nd floor as residential apartment valuing approximately Rs 27,35,186 which belongs to a drug peddler Mohammad Maqbool Bhat alias Tola, son of Ali Mohammad Bhat, resident of Dalipora Pulwama, spokesman said.
He said the action follows a thorough investigation, identifying these properties as illegally acquired during the course of illicit drug trafficking. Both individuals are currently under legal custody, police said.
The attachment was carried out in accordance with the due legal process outlined in FIR No. 301/2023 U/S 8/21-29 NDPS Act of PS Pulwama, underscoring the vigilant stance of Pulwama Police against those involved in the drug trade, the spokesman said.
